  • Hello,

    Actually, I created a tileset with Illustrator, with 300 DPI for Higher Definition.

    In the workspace, each tile is 32x32 pixels.

    The fact is, when I export, the pixel difference is ~4.16666667*higher than expected, obviously because there is a difference between 72dpi and 300dpi (300 / 72 = 4.16666667).

    The first problem I saw was that I exported the tileset from Illustrator only, not the whole workspace so it deleted the transparent blank space all around and obviously generated an offset. Now, this problem is gone, but there is some other problems.

    There is an offset appearing as you can see. It drives me crazy actually, I don't understand why it does this.

    When I import the PNG into construct 3, how should I specify the grid x&y values below ?

  • A tilemap should be used for things that tile.

    Remember that it's one atlus of objects in one texture, that usually covers the entire layout.

    So you save cpu, and gpu by having one static thing that takes up a set amount of ram.

    Multiple different Tilemap objects lower those ram savings.

    Multiple objects work the same way.

    A layout full of instances is not an issue, unless they are moving.

    Also it looks like you have a lot of wasted space. Tilemaps usually have objects close together as in a minimum of 1 pixel apart to maximise ram saving.

    You usually have to do that manually.

  • > Have you tried to edit the image in an image editor (ex. photoshop) and change the dpi from 300 to 72 while keeping the dimensions?

    I already did this with Illustrator, it ends with a lower quality like, you know, pixellised :/

    I meant:

    » open the exported Illustrator 300dpi image in photoshop,

    » Go to change image size,

    » write down original width and height,

    » change de dpi to 72 (it will change the image width and height)

    » change image width and height to the original values and apply

    Save the image and try that in construct.

    You are only changing the interpreted dpi for the image, not scaling it from 300 (usually for print) to 72 (usually for screen).

  • Ok, I figured out (I deleted the last two posts to avoid multi-posting spam...)

    I found the solution with the tip from BadMario (thanks!):

    I updated the tiles in my workspace from 32x32 to 256x256

    Then I exported in 72dpi (no scaling)

    It's all good ingame.
